Depends if you want to see the whole field run, or the eliminations?
The first day everyone should get at least 1 run (so you will see all the cars) but then as the weekend progresses and people get bumped from running, the racing may get more frantic with people pushing the cars more ![]() Put it this way - the best day for the Pod (although I know its too far - im using this as an example) when Top Fuel is on (and its a 3/4 day event) is usually the Sunday. The slower cars will have run already, the big boys would have been out on Saturday for 'test' runs - so will be turning up the wick on the Sunday to make sure they are in with a chance on the Monday....with the addition of seeing the whole field run during qualifying, win win ![]() |
